Disappointed Girlfriend Gathers More Support To Ruin Ex-Military Lover’s Wedding

Social media is boiling as the brouhaha surrounding the wedding of the embattled Military man moves to a different level.

The wedding is scheduled to take place this Saturday, 20 March, 2021, at Obuasi in the Ashanti Region of Ghana.

The lady, comfort Bliss as she is affectionately called, narrated her ordeal and pleaded with social media for support.

According to Comfort, her ex-military boyfriend, Richard Agu promised her marriage some years ago. Comfort further indicated that she sponsored Richard Angu’s entry into the military and took care of him until he passed out.

She added that after Richard Angu started receiving salary, he jilted her for another women. Comfort indicated that she spent over 30,000 Ghana Cedis on Richard and that money must be paid back before he can go ahead to have his wedding.

  Comfort has vowed to destroy the wedding at Obuasi if she does not receive her money. The story of Comfort has gained momentum on Social Media as many Ghanaians have expressed their support to her.

According to them Richard is an opportunist who treated Comfort unfairly and must be made to pay back the money.

 

There are several others who have vowed to storm the wedding ceremony to witness what may happen. Already, Richard Agu and his soon to be wife have had their traditional wedding and the white wedding is happening in few hours.

 

Expectations are high among Ghanaian who are backing comfort to go for her money.
